Minutes — Management Meeting: Hollis Unit Sale

Quick recap for sales leads: the deal to offload the Hollis packaging unit to Branford Group is basically done — final signatures expected next week. Keep selling as normal; accounts transfer after close. Don't discuss terms with customers yet. Comp plans are unaffected this quarter. Details on what comes next are below.

internal memo for fahaf-yajog: Jorirox Partners is in early talks to buy Belaxek Systems for about $407.6 million. The Fraius launch date is October 14, and nothing goes to the press before then. Legal wants the Gilionek Partners term sheet withdrawn before February 11.

### Step 4: Cut over the loyalty ledger

Once Pointsmith finishes backfilling, the old Tallyhut ledger goes read-only. Support folks: customers may see a short lag before new points appear — that's expected, usually under five minutes. Don't manually adjust balances during the cutover window; the reconciler will fix drift on its own. The new ledger service starts with the following settings:

deployment values, yadug-bawif:
[framir]
team = pelox
access_code = ac_a38ab2
owner = tamion.julael
host = framir.tolvaqlabs.test
port = 11211
peer = tammir.zemvargrid.local
salt = 2215ef03
pin = 1541

Welcome to the RestockRoute team at Pellwick Systems. RestockRoute is our vending-machine restock planner: it ingests telemetry from cabinet sensors, forecasts sell-through per slot, and generates driver routes for the Marlow depot region. Before you can run the planner locally, you will need access to the planning vault, which stores route seeds and depot credentials. Request vault membership from your onboarding buddy, then verify your login works in the staging console. If the vault ever rejects your key, use the recovery passphrase below.

unlock words, yawig-kagef: gordor-holvan-ulaael-pramir-ulaiel-tamdor